Johnny's Pork Roll and Coffee Too (Red Bank) vs. Beach Shack Deli (Point Pleasant Beach)

The championship comes down to a shop that is one of the biggest names in pork roll in New Jersey and a beach town spot open May through September.

The sandwiches at Johnny's in Red Bank are made with pork roll that is sliced thin and cooked till crispy (owner John Yarusi treats it like bacon). For summer visitors in Point Pleasant Beach, a day isn't complete without a breakfast sandwich from the seasonal Beach Shack Deli.
